Historical Uses of Aloe Vera
Little is known about the exact origins of aloe vera, but it is believed to have been used for its healing properties for centuries. Ancient civilizations such as the Egyptians, Greeks, and Romans recorded the use of aloe vera for various medicinal purposes, including treating wounds, skin infections, and digestive issues.
The Science Behind Aloe Vera’s Healing Properties
Overview: Aloe vera is a succulent plant known for its thick, gel-filled leaves that contain a plethora of beneficial compounds. Research has shown that aloe vera possesses anti-inflammatory, antimicrobial, and antioxidant properties, making it a popular choice for treating various skin conditions, digestive issues, and even gum inflammation.

Science: Studies have identified key components in aloe vera gel, such as acemannan, a complex carbohydrate that has immune-boosting and anti-inflammatory effects. Additionally, aloe vera is rich in vitamins, minerals, and enzymes that contribute to its healing properties. These compounds work together to promote tissue repair, reduce inflammation, and soothe irritated gums, making aloe vera a valuable ingredient in natural oral care products.

Methods of Using Aloe Vera for Oral Care
On top of being available in gel form, aloe vera can be used for oral care in several ways. You can directly apply the gel onto the affected gum area, add a few drops of aloe vera juice to your mouthwash, or even mix it with water for a natural mouth rinse. Whichever method you choose, aloe vera can help alleviate gum inflammation and provide relief.
Safety and Considerations When Using Aloe Vera
Application of aloe vera for oral care is generally considered safe for most people. However, there are some considerations to keep in mind. While aloe vera is known for its healing properties, ingesting large amounts of aloe vera gel or juice can cause digestive issues. It’s important to use aloe vera externally for gum inflammation and consult a healthcare professional before consuming it internally.

Complementary Herbal Remedies for Enhanced Oral Health
For a more holistic approach to oral care, consider integrating complementary herbal remedies alongside aloe vera. Herbs like sage, peppermint, and tea tree oil have antibacterial and anti-inflammatory properties that can further enhance the health of your gums and teeth. You can find these herbs in toothpaste, mouthwash, or even create your own herbal mouth rinse at home.
Remedies rich in these herbs can help reduce plaque buildup, fight off harmful bacteria, and soothe inflamed gums. When combined with aloe vera, these herbal remedies create a potent blend that promotes overall oral health and prevents gum disease. Remember to consult with a healthcare provider before incorporating new herbs into your routine, especially if you have any existing health conditions or are pregnant.
